On August 20, 2026, Revance Therapeutics and Swiss manufacturer Teoxane announced FDA approval of RHA Redensity® Eye
an HA (hyaluronic acid) filler indicated specifically for infraorbital hollows in adults aged 22 and older.
The approval targets moderate-to-severe volume loss beneath the eye.

The press release also flags a broader market shift:
the under-eye area is described as one of the regions most susceptible to fat loss
in patients undergoing GLP-1 receptor agonist therapy (Ozempic, Wegovy, Mounjaro).
As weight-loss medications reshape bodies — and faces — aesthetic medicine is adapting.

Under-Eye Hollows vs. Dark Circles vs. Tear Troughs — Why the Distinction Matters

Under-eye concerns fall into three distinct categories.
Confusing them leads to treatments that miss the mark.

Dark Circles
Caused by pigmentation, visible vasculature, or shadowing.
Subtypes (brown, blue, black) have different origins and require different treatments.
Fillers often do not resolve true dark circles.
Tear Trough
A groove running along the lower eyelid margin.
Common even in younger patients, and anatomically distinct from the broader infraorbital hollow.
Infraorbital Hollow ← This approval’s indication
A broader zone of volume deficiency below the orbital rim,
caused by age-related or weight-loss-related fat and soft tissue reduction.
This area moves with every facial expression,
demanding a filler material that can flex and recover without distortion.

Most complaints of “looking tired or aged around the eyes” correspond to this third category.
Fillers are a valid treatment option — but until now, no HA gel had been specifically designed and FDA-approved for this zone.

What Is RHA Redensity Eye? Two Defining Features

💡 What Is PNT (Preserved Network Technology)?
Developed by Teoxane (Switzerland), PNT uses a thermal-free, uniform cross-linking process
that preserves the natural structure of hyaluronic acid chains.
The result is described as a “resilient HA” — one that moves with facial expressions
rather than resisting them.
For a high-mobility area like the under-eye, this material design is clinically relevant.
Feature 1 — First U.S. infraorbital trial to include PRO as a co-primary endpoint
PRO (Patient-Reported Outcome) measures whether patients themselves perceive improvement —
not just the treating physician.
Conventional filler trials have relied exclusively on clinician-graded scales.
According to Revance, this is the first U.S. infraorbital hollow study
to elevate PRO to co-primary endpoint status.
It means the approval is grounded in both physician assessment and patient experience.
Feature 2 — Highest dynamic strength and extensibility among under-eye HA fillers (manufacturer claim)
Revance states that RHA Redensity Eye offers the highest dynamic strength and extensibility
among HA fillers for the under-eye area.
This claim is based on manufacturer data, not independent third-party comparative research.
Readers should weigh it accordingly.

Reading the Clinical Data Accurately — What “79%” and “93%” Each Mean

Two numbers circulate in coverage of this approval.
They are not interchangeable.

📊 Two Data Points — Different Sources, Different Criteria

79.0%Responder rate at 12 weeks — FDA Instructions for Use (IFU), P170002S050D
Randomized, evaluator-blinded, untreated-control, multicenter, prospective trial.
Untreated control group: 9.8%. Statistically significant difference confirmed.
93%Patients showing aesthetic improvement at 3 months — Revance press release, August 20, 2026
Duration of effect cited as up to 12 months.
Evaluation criteria and time points differ from the IFU figure; direct comparison is not valid.

On safety, the FDA IFU documents the following:
No treatment-related serious adverse events.
No delayed adverse events, no vascular occlusion, no granuloma or delayed inflammatory reactions.
Common side effects were injection-site redness, swelling, pain, and bruising —
consistent with the standard filler safety profile.

💡 GLP-1 Therapy and Facial Volume Loss
GLP-1 receptor agonists — including semaglutide (Ozempic / Wegovy) and tirzepatide (Mounjaro) —
produce rapid, significant weight loss.
As total body fat decreases, facial fat and soft tissue diminish as well.
The under-eye area, temples, and cheeks are particularly prone to visible hollowing.
The resulting complaint — “my body is slimmer but my face looks older” —
is generating a new category of demand within aesthetic medicine.

Demand for facial volume restoration among GLP-1 users is measurably rising.
The timing of RHA Redensity Eye’s approval aligns with this shift.
Aesthetic medicine is actively developing a response to what weight-loss drugs leave behind on the face.

Frequently Asked Questions

Are there non-filler options for infraorbital hollows?
Yes. Alternatives include autologous fat grafting, biostimulators (e.g., Sculptra, Radiesse),
and surgical orbital fat repositioning (blepharoplasty).
Fillers offer immediacy and reversibility (via hyaluronidase),
but if the primary concern is pigmentation-based dark circles rather than volume loss,
fillers will not resolve the issue.
Accurate diagnosis by an experienced clinician is the essential first step.
Can I get under-eye filler while on GLP-1 medications like Ozempic or Wegovy?
No universal contraindication guideline currently exists.
However, during periods of rapid weight change, the required filler volume and aesthetic outcome
can shift significantly as facial fat continues to redistribute.
Many clinicians recommend waiting until body weight stabilizes
before pursuing facial volume restoration.
Disclose your GLP-1 use to both your prescribing physician and your aesthetic provider.
